Command Usage
â—†
The SSH server supports up to eight client sessions. The maximum number of
client sessions includes both current Telnet sessions and SSH sessions.
â—†
The SSH server uses DSA or RSA for key exchange when the client first
establishes a connection with the switch, and then negotiates with the client to
select either DES (56-bit) or 3DES (168-bit) for data encryption.
â—†
You must generate DSA and RSA host keys before enabling the SSH server.
Example
Console#ip ssh crypto host-key generate dsa
Console#configure
Console(config)#ip ssh server
Console(config)#

ip ssh server-key size
This command sets the SSH server key size. Use the
no
form to restore the default
setting.
Syntax
ip ssh server-key size
key-size
no ip ssh server-key size
key-size – The size of server key. (Range: 512-896 bits)
Default Setting
768 bits
Command Mode
Global Configuration
Command Usage
The server key is a private key that is never shared outside the switch.
The host key is shared with the SSH client, and is fixed at 1024 bits.
Example
Console(config)#ip ssh server-key size 512
Console(config)#
